Understanding Blast and SOL Airdrop Mechanics
Blast is an Ethereum Layer-2 network designed for speed and yield generation, while SOL is Solana’s native token. Receiving SOL airdrops on Blast typically involves one of two scenarios:
- Wrapped SOL (wSOL): Projects may airdrop wrapped SOL tokens bridged from Solana to Blast’s EVM-compatible environment
- Cross-chain rewards: Protocols might distribute SOL as incentives for Blast network participation
- Partnership initiatives: Collaborative airdrops between Solana-based projects and Blast ecosystems
Unlike native Blast token airdrops, SOL distributions require additional steps due to cross-chain complexities. Always verify official project announcements to avoid scams.

Essential Security Measures
Protect your assets while pursuing SOL airdrops:
- Never share private keys or seed phrases
- Verify contract addresses via Etherscan
- Use hardware wallets for significant holdings
- Enable transaction signing confirmations
- Bookmark official project websites to avoid phishing

Are SOL airdrops on Blast taxable?
In most jurisdictions, airdrops count as taxable income at fair market value upon receipt. Consult a crypto tax professional for guidance.
Can I use a Solana wallet like Phantom?
Not directly. You need an EVM wallet (MetaMask, etc.) for Blast activities. Consider multi-chain wallets that support both ecosystems.
